Medical emergency for older man at health care facility, Bremen IN
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
A 73-year-old man at Signature Health Care near Woody's Lane was having a medical emergency with low oxygen levels, rapid pulse, and vomiting a dark coffee ground colored substance. Emergency medical services transported him to the emergency room.
